B O W L - 1 0 1 g Bowling league management program for the IBM and compatibles. This program will work on any IBM compatible computer with at least 298k of free ram, any monitor and printer, one or more drives. It does require Dos 2.1 or above. BOWL101g is a user friendly, but very powerful program. It can be configured to run almost any type of league, mixed, scratch, all male or all female. The program is a menu driven program using pull down menus and pop up help screens. There are 70 help screens to guide you through the program if you need them, (just press the F1 key) but are out of the way of an experienced user. Full featured editing. Edit any bowler or team score while entering data or edit them individually from the main menu with page up page down capability. Traverse through the program with the arrow keys, pg up, pg down and ESC keys It will handle match or Peterson points and games bowled can be three or four. The program handles subs in a logical manner by temporarily placing them on the team they bowl on. This allows for difficult situations where a bowler bowls one or two games and is replaced by a sub. All scores are taken care of automatically. There is a built in calendar and pop up calculator. Subs are added to the sub roster as they bowl. The roster keeps growing as subs are added. The first sub on the list of subs you pick from is "NOT LISTED". Picking this allows you to add a new sub. The program is almost completely automatic. After the initial startup, all that is necessary is to enter the three or four scores bowled by each bowler. High games and series are calculated for you. There is an option to let you manually enter the number of wins if your league uses a different type of scoring system not handled by BOWL101g. Some other options are as follows..... Seperate handicaps for male or female. Maximum handicap for male or female. Minimum handicap. (allows handicap to drop to a negative handicap.) Set the number of points each bowler receives if using match points. Set the number of points per game and series. Lets you set a maximum score larger than 300 (5 pin bowling or duckpin) Keep averages for a given number of games (0 - 99). Adjusts for position rounds if your league uses them. Auto lane assignment.
